Job Description

Engineering Technician to support the Houston A&D team on day-to-day functions. The candidate will work alongside engineers, geologists and investment banking professionals to derive financial valuations for use in acquisitions and divestitures, corporate M&A and general client services.

  • Conduct short-term studies and economic analysis for A&D opportunities

  • Responsible for managing and absorbing VDRs to generate field evaluations

  • Generate type curves with supporting economic parameters to evaluate economic results

  • Prepare economic models for single well and life of field

  • Generate single well forecasts in ARIES and/or QC existing databases

  • Analyze lease operating statements and create field expense models and projections

  • Work with geology to understand sub-surface properties and impact on well performance

  • Additional duties and responsibilities as assigned

Knowledge, Education & Experience

  • 6 years of industry and or banking experience

  • Proficient in ARIES with minimum 3 years of experience

  • Detailed oriented and is well versed in Upstream workflows (i.e. type curve analysis, cost structure, oil & gas financials, etc.)

  • Ability to work with multiple and changing priorities, fast-paced environment, short deadlines and the ability to respond in high-stress situations

  • Proficient in reserve evaluation and economic analysis of petroleum assets

  • Basic knowledge of geology, drilling, completions, production engineering, and production operations

  • Proficient in Excel, Access, PPT, Enverus, and Tableau or Spotfire

  • Data analytics experience, ability to extract data from large structured and unstructured data sets

  • Personable with strong communication skills, team oriented and line of site to presenting in front of clients
